Output 62c6d4183f355c59e43abaad4b083ff392c7feb76d59db8e8a2766f70896e3ea:0

value
337442
script pubkey
OP_HASH160 OP_PUSHBYTES_20 191f9a4827cb990572099eea61ecf940d55b772d OP_EQUAL
address
MABzz1y8pqhZ33sLNohRQjwm62gFMqsyPy
transaction
62c6d4183f355c59e43abaad4b083ff392c7feb76d59db8e8a2766f70896e3ea
spent
true